ХТМЛ5 - колачићи

Преглед садржаја
Колачићи су мали подаци који се чувају у прегледачу особе која посећује страницу, тако да се могу имати неки подаци о њиховом кретању на одређеној страници, а тиме када особа поново посети веб локацију можемо персонализовати њихово искуство навигације , или приказујући резултате који се односе на вашу претходну посету, или одмах приказују ваше личне податке.
Витх ХТМЛ5 и објекат документа Можемо писати колачиће користећи Јавасцрипт језик, захваљујући чему можемо проширити функционалност наших страница, нудећи робусније искуство прегледавања.
Читање и писање колачића
Као што смо на почетку споменули, захваљујући објекту документ Можемо руковати колачићима, са следећим кодом ћемо направити мали пример овога, како бисмо разумели како се процеси изводе:
 Пример Додавање колачића Колачић за ажурирање 

Својство колачића функционише на необичан начин, када очитамо вредност својства, добијамо све колачиће који су повезани са документом. Колачићи имају структуру парова име / вредност и можете видети име = вредност.
Сада када се добије неколико колачића, видећемо да ћемо их добити раздвојене тачком и зарезом на следећи начин: име1 = вредност1; име2 = вредност2; име3 = вредност3. И тако даље са свиме што имамо.
Сада, када додајемо колачић, понашање је следеће, додељујемо нови пар име / вредност као вредност својства колачића објекта документа и на тај начин се додају колачићи документа. У овом процесу можемо додати само један колачић одједном, ако доделимо вредност која одговара постојећем називу колачића, он ће бити ажуриран том вредношћу.
Када разјаснимо начин на који колачићи функционишу, објаснићемо код који смо унели, видимо да имамо два дугмета у документу, сваком је додељена функција Додај колачић за додавање колачића и Ажурирајте колачић да их ажурирамо, када користимо прву, функција се активира цреатеЦоокие који ствара нови пар име / вредност који ће бити додат у збирку колачића документа, друго дугме ће позвати функцију упдатеЦоокие који ће доделити нову вредност постојећем колачићу.
Погледајмо снимак екрана како би овај код требало да ради у нашем прегледачу:

Имамо и неке додатне особине које можемо користити за руковање колачићима, погледајмо следећу листу:
  • путања = Поставља путању повезану са колачићем, подразумевано је то путања тренутног документа.
  • домен = Он успоставља домен повезан са колачићем, подразумевано узима вредност домена тренутног документа.
  • мак-аге = Успоставља живот колачића, броји се у секундама и почиње да се рачуна од тренутка када је направљен.
  • истиче = Подесите датум истека колачића користећи временску зону ГМТ. Ова опција је доступна само за коришћење преко ХТТПС везе.
Да бисмо користили ова својства, морамо их додати после тачке и зарезе при постављању вредности колачића, на пример доцумент.цоокие = "МиЦоокие = Моја вредност; мак-аге = 10"; Да ли вам се допао и помогао овај водич?Можете наградити аутора притиском на ово дугме да бисте му дали позитиван поен
wave wave wave wave wave